1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
the line that marked the division between slave states and non-slave states
Back
the 36°30' latitude
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What legislation declared states north of the 36° 30' were to remain free states?
Back
Missouri Compromise
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What 1850's novel helped Northerners to understand the evils of slavery and contributed to anti-slavery feeling in the North?
Back
Uncle Tom's Cabin
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Allowing the people of a U.S. territory to vote to decide if they want slavery in their territory is referred to as:
Back
Popular Sovereignty
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Hiram Revels was the first African-American -
Back
U.S. Senator
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which of the following made "all persons born or naturalized in the United States" citizens of the nation? 13th Amendment, 14th Amendment, 15th Amendment, Reconstruction Act of 1867
Back
14th Amendment
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The Emancipation Proclamation said that if the Union won the war, “all slaves would be forever free”. This was officially the law of the United States with the passage of which amendment?
Back
13th Amendment
